I'm using 2.4.18-rc1 with the preempt patch and whenever I run fsck, it keeps finding more and more errors. Specifically those related to corrupted orphan linked lists. I dont know what is going on but I know it's not the drives because they were all tested before partitioning under an older (woody's kernel) and everything was fine (bad block test). No matter how many times I run fsck, even immediately after a previous run, it picks up the same errors along with new ones it seemingly created in the last run. if there is any more information about the problem I can give just say what's needed.
